Theme parks prioritize visitor safety through various robust measures, 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ience.

Q1: What are the primary safety measures in theme parks?
  • **Ride Inspections:** Regular and rigorous safety checks of all rides before park opening.
  • **Staff Training:** Extensive training for staff on safety protocols and emergency response.
  • **Security Presence:** High visibility of security personnel and constant surveillance to discourage inappropriate behavior.
  • **First Aid Facilities:** Well-equipped first aid stations staffed with trained medical personnel.
  • **Height Restrictions:** Clearly marked height requirements for rides to ensure suitability for diverse age groups.
Q2: How do theme parks ensure the safety of their rides?

Ride safety in theme parks is a critical concern, managed through several stringent processes:

  • **Daily Checks:** Each ride undergoes daily operational checks.
  • **Maintenance Schedule:** Regular maintenance periods and off-season overhauls.
  • **Technology:** Use of advanced technology to automatically detect faults or potential failures.

Q3: What specific training do theme park employees receive for safety?
  • **Emergency Response Training:** Employees are trained in CPR, first-aid, and evacuation procedures.
  • **Operational Training:** Specific training on the safe operation of rides and equipment.
  • **Customer Interaction:** Training on handling guest inquiries safely and effectively, including managing large crowds.

Introduction to Safety in Theme Parks

Theme parks are complex entertainment hubs that attract millions of visitors annually. Ensuring the safety of these visitors is paramount, which requires sophisticated systems and practices. In this extended answer, we will explore the top safety measures that are commonplace in theme parks worldwide, focusing on their implementation and importance.

Safety Training and Staff Preparedness

One of the primary safety measures in theme parks is the thorough training of staff. Employees are trained to handle a variety of emergency situations, including ride malfunctions, medical emergencies, and evacuation procedures. Regular drills and ongoing training sessions ensure that all team members are prepared and aware of their roles and responsibilities in maintaining visitor safety.

Ride Maintenance and Regular Inspection

Rides and attractions are subjected to daily inspections and regular maintenance to ensure they operate safely. Mechanical components are checked for wear and tear, and any potential issues are addressed promptly to prevent accidents. Advanced diagnostic tools and technologies are employed to monitor rides and systems in real time, aiding in the early detection of potential malfunctions.

Use of Technology in Monitoring and Control Systems

Modern theme parks utilize advanced technology to enhance safety. This includes the use of sophisticated ride control systems that can automatically detect and react to safety threats. Surveillance cameras and sensors are strategically placed throughout the park to monitor activities and manage large crowds, ensuring a safe and enjoyable environment for all visitors.

Conclusion

In conclusion, the safety of visitors in theme parks is ensured through a combination of staff training, regular maintenance, and the integration of advanced technologies. These measures are crucial for preventing accidents and ensuring that all visitors have a safe and enjoyable experience.
